Services for Young People projects enable young people in all districts of Hertfordshire to develop their personal and social skills and increase their confidence, self-esteem and resilience.

Young people can get involved in exciting activities and discussions, learn new skills and get support from our Youth Workers on any concerns they may have.

Professionals, parents/carers or young people themselves can contact their local team to join or make a referral.

At Services for Young People (SfYP) projects qualified Youth Workers deliver curriculum programmes to support young people:


SfYP also delivers weekly street projects and Friday night projects in all districts and provides a range of support for care experienced young people up to the age of 24.

Young people can also get confidential one-to-one support at their local Access Point Project.
